Areas of Practice: Commercial Litigation

Law School: University of Dayton School of Law, J.D., 2004

Undergraduate: Miami University, B.A., Political Science, 2001


A former summer clerk of the firm, Erin joined FI&C full time in August 2004 and has participated in various aspects of the firm's litigation practice, including securities fraud and class action defense. Erin is licensed to practice law before the Supreme Court of Ohio and the United States District Court for the Southern District of Ohio.

Erin is a member of the American, Ohio and Dayton Bar Associations, and is actively involved in her local legal community, focusing her efforts on community service and legal education. In 2006, Erin co-founded the Dayton Bar Association's 5 for the Kids, 5K race to benefit CARE House, an advocacy center for child victims of abuse and neglect, and acted as co-chair of the race in 2007 and 2008. In spring 2008, Erin was recognized by the Ohio State Bar Association Foundation for her efforts regarding 5 for the Kids, and was awarded the Community Service Award for Lawyers 40 and Under. Erin is also an adjunct professor at the University of Dayton School of Law and, from 2004 through 2008, she acted as legal advisor for Chaminade Julienne High School's mock trial team.

Erin has also published several articles for national and local publications, including two recent articles in The Federal Lawyer magazine regarding the heightened pleading standards associated with securities fraud litigation. Since 2007, Erin has been acting Chair of the Bar Briefs Editorial Board. Bar Briefs is the official publication of the Dayton Bar Association.

A graduate of the University of Dayton School of Law, Erin was a recipient of the Presidential Scholarship, a member of the Honor Council and a published staff writer for the Dayton Law Review. Erin also received a CALI award honoring her academic excellence in Administrative Law. During her time in law school, Erin clerked for the former Immigration and Naturalization Service, Office of the District Counsel, in Chicago, Illinois and acted as a law clerk for Judge John M. Meagher, Ret., who has a private arbitration and mediation practice based in Dayton, Ohio.

While attending Miami University, Erin participated in a study abroad program where she traveled throughout Western Europe studying International Accounting and International Business Law. Erin was also an active member of the Kappa Alpha Theta fraternity and the Order of Omega honors fraternity.
